Reactions of TeF5OCl with Fluorocarbon Iodides and Synthesis of CF3OTeF5.

1990 
Abstract The low temperature reaction of TeF 5 OCl with the fluorocarbon iodides, CF 3 I, C 2 F 5 I, n-C 3 F 7 I, and i-C 3 F 7 I results in the formation of R f I(OTeF 5 ) 2 adducts. Except for the trifluoromethyl derivative these are stable, colorless compounds. The trifluoromethyl adduct decomposes above −78°C to give the previously unknown CF 3 OTeF 5 . The perfluoroethyl and n-propyl adducts decompose at 120°C or under UV radiation giving C 2 F 5 OTeF 5 and n- C 3 F 7 OTeF 5 , respectively. These reactions constitute a new synthesis of primary R f OTef 5 compounds. Attempts to extend this synthesis to secondary fluorocarbon iodides were unsuccessful.
